SSH, or Secure Shell, is a network protocol that is used to connect to a server and conduct different tasks using a command line. The protocol is used by many expert users, due to the fact that the data transmitted over it is encrypted, so it may not be intercepted on the way by a third party. SSH access can be employed for a variety of things depending on the type of Internet hosting account. With a shared hosting account, in particular, SSH is among the ways to import/export a database or to upload a file when the hosting server permits it. In case you have a virtual or a dedicated server, SSH can be used for pretty much anything - you could install software or restart specific services such as the web server or the database server which run on the machine. SSH is used mainly with UNIX-like Platforms, but there are clients which permit you to employ the protocol if your PC is running a different OS as well. The connection is created on TCP port 22 by default and the remote web server always listens for incoming connections on that port although lots of providers change it for security reasons.

SSH Telnet in VPS Hosting

When you get a new virtual private server from us, it will feature full root access and you shall be able to connect to the server and to control everything using an SSH console. The function is included as standard with all package deals, so you shall not need to enable or upgrade anything. Your website hosting server will be set up soon after you get it and the instant you get the Welcome e-mail with the login details, you can connect via the server’s main IP address and begin working. Given that the VPS is a software emulation of a dedicated server and is isolated from the other accounts inside the physical machine, there'll be no restrictions in terms of the commands which you can use. You'll have full root access, so that you can install and run any application that can work on a Linux hosting server, manage files, folders and databases or start/stop/reboot the whole machine or any software running on it.
